REVIEW by Jeff Ascough, UK

I’ve never been one for buying books on wedding photography. I find that they date quickly, the pictures are usually poorly printed, and the content is lacking. Most books are about as attractive as watching Manchester City vs  Newcastle United on a cold, wet November afternoon. It seems anyone can put out a book these days and some of the more recent ones, especially on this side of the pond, have been truly awful.
However, this book by Marcus has rekindled my faith in wedding photography books. It’s exceptional.
Marcus is a phenomenal photographer, a great friend, and a wonderfully warm human being. This book is special because all of these things come through in both the text and the pictures that are contained within the book. This book is all about Marcus. It doesn’t try to be anything else. It’s about his vision, his technique and philosophy.
You can’t have a wedding photography book without images. And boy does this book have some really great pictures. He could have removed all the text and simply put a book together of his photographs. I would have been very happy with that. Some of his best known images are highlighted as well as others which aren’t so well known. The images are powerful, fun, romantic, emotional, and every so often I just have to smile and appreciate the sheer god-given talent that this man has got when it comes to shooting weddings.
The added bonus is, of course, the thoughts and ideas that come out of every page. Marcus covers pretty much everything anyone would ever want to know about the mechanics and philosophy of shooting a wedding. From what to do at church, through to post processing and album design. He even covers business and marketing ideas. Yeah I know many books do this, but what you get here is far deeper than simply telling you how to press the button. You learn about Marcus’ life, his personal experiences, and his whole reason for him being a wedding photographer. That’s what makes this book unique. Sections of the book are almost autobiographical, and that for me is a great touch.
In my opinion, this is one of the best books that has ever been written on wedding photography. The quality of the images are worth the cover price alone. But it’s the text, the ideas, the sheer inspiration, and the fact that Marcus is one of the few authors that actually walks the walk, that makes this book so special.
Whether you are a complete newcomer to the business, or a seasoned pro, you will love this book. Just go and buy it. You won’t be disappointed.
